Method
Preparation of Gelatin
- In a small bowl, sprinkle the gelatin powder over cold water and allow it to bloom.
Making the Cream
- In a saucepan, combine 1 cup of heavy cream, whole milk, and granulated sugar. Add the split vanilla bean or vanilla extract.
- Bring the mixture to a simmer and let it steep for 15-20 minutes to capture all the flavors.
- In a separate bowl, whisk the egg yolks. Temper these yolks by gradually adding the warm cream mixture.
- Return the mixture to low heat, stirring until it coats the back of a spoon, about 5-7 minutes.
- Stir in the bloomed gelatin until fully dissolved. Strain the mixture into a bowl and allow it to cool slightly before folding in the remaining whipped cream.
- Pour into serving dishes and refrigerate for at least 4 hours until firm.
Preparing the Berries
- In a bowl, mix the fresh berries with granulated sugar and lemon juice. Let them macerate until ready to serve.
Serving
- Once the Bavarian cream is set, top each serving with the macerated berries and a sprig of mint before serving.
